The 2018 Davidson Wildcats football team represented Davidson College in the 2018 NCAA Division I FCS football season.They were led by first-year head coach Scott Abell and played their home games at Richardson Stadium.They were members of the Pioneer Football League (PFL). The 2013 Davidson Wildcats football team represented Davidson College in the 2013 NCAA Division I FCS football season.They were led by first-year head coach Paul Nichols and played their home games at Richardson Stadium.They were a member of the Pioneer Football League.They finished the season 0–11, 0–8 in PFL play to finish in eleventh place. In 1929, donations from Henry Smith Richardson (class of 1906) and Lunsford Richardson (1914), in memory of their father, Lunsford Richardson (1875), made possible construction of a new football stadium.
